Mehrangarh Fort: A Majestic Fortress

The first stop, Mehrangarh Fort, is a sprawling structure towering over the city. With 2.5 hours allocated, you’ll have plenty of time to explore the ramparts, courtyards, and the museum inside. The fort’s impressive architecture and commanding views of Jodhpur are what make it a must-visit. Reviewers mention that the guide is very informative without rushing, giving you space to soak in the history and atmosphere. While admission isn’t included, many find the exterior and panoramic vistas alone worth the visit.

Jaswant Thada: A Serene Garden Oasis

Next, you’ll visit Jaswant Thada, a beautiful marble mausoleum surrounded by well-maintained gardens. The one-hour stop offers a peaceful setting to appreciate the intricate carvings and the lush greenery. One reviewer highlights the stunning gardens and the calm ambiance, making this a perfect spot for photos and reflection.

Umaid Bhawan Palace: A Regal Landmark

Your tour continues with a visit to Umaid Bhawan Palace, now a heritage hotel. Spending about an hour here allows you to admire the architectural grandeur and learn about its fascinating history. While the interior isn’t included, the exterior alone offers plenty of photo opportunities. Many visitors say the guide’s insights help bring the palace’s story to life.

Desert Camel Safari: Sunset in Osian

After a full morning of sightseeing, the journey takes you approximately 60 km outside the city to Osian for the camel safari. The 30-40 minute ride is a highlight, offering a unique perspective of the Rajasthan landscape. Many reviewers note that the camel ride is a relaxing, scenic experience and a great way to witness the desert’s tranquility. Some suggest that if you’re pressed for time, the camel ride is optional, but most agree it’s a memorable part of the tour.

FAQ

Are entrance fees included in the tour?
No, the tour price does not include entrance fees for the sites like Mehrangarh Fort, Jaswant Thada, or Umaid Bhawan Palace. You might want to bring extra cash for tickets.

Is this tour suitable for all ages?
Yes, most travelers can participate, as long as they’re comfortable with walking and a camel ride. It’s a full day, so plan accordingly for young children or older travelers.

Can I customize the itinerary?
This is a private tour, so you can discuss your preferences with the guide. If you want more time at certain sites or to skip others, it’s usually possible.

What is included in the price?
The tour covers hotel pickup and drop-off, private transportation in an air-conditioned vehicle, a camel ride, and the services of an English-speaking driver and guide (if booked).

How long is the camel safari?
The camel ride lasts approximately 30 to 40 minutes, offering a scenic view of the desert landscape during sunset.
